<h3>What is Annual Rainfall Graph?</h3>
This refers to the climatic graph which is used to show the average rainfall which is recorded for a particular rainfall in a given time frame.
With this in mind, we can see that this can be represented on a line graph or on a bar graph and the data are recorded on the same axes.

The ability to identify where you are, that is locating your space and evaluating it in relation to someplace else, is known as spatial analysis. This ability will help you better to understand where and what is occurring in your world, but also to solve location-oriented problems and answer complex spatial questions.
There's few methods how governments can promote solutions for climate disruptions:
1. Strictly regulate carbon dioxide (CO2) and methane as air pollutants
2. Phaze in carbon taxes or fees
3. Place a cap on total human generated carbon dioxide and methane emissions
4. Increase subsidies to businesses that encourage energy efficient technology

A territorial dispute or boundary dispute is a disagreement over the possession or control of land between two or more territorial entities.
